As state health policy leadership becomes more important and more challenging, the Milbank Memorial Fund is launching recruitment for the 2025-2026 cohorts of the Milbank Memorial Fund’s two leadership programs for legislative and executive branch government officials who are committed to improving population health:
These programs, all costs of which are covered by Milbank, provide a unique opportunity for participants to engage with colleagues from across the country; enhance their leadership skills; learn from experts about pressing health policy topics; and improve their capacity to advance population health policy in their communities.
